Benzodiazepine and zolpidem prescriptions during autologous stem cell transplantation
Multiple myeloma patients undergoing autologous stem cell transplantation (ASCT) may receive benzodiazepine or zolpidem‐class (B/Z) medications despite their risks in older patients.
